Prize bonds of SBP worth Rs.30mn stolen

TOP NEWS

KARACHI: Prize bonds of State Bank of Pakistan (SBP) worth Rs.30 million were stolen during its transportation from Lahore to Karachi, ARY News reported on Saturday.

Ten boxes of SBP’s prize bonds were being transported via Karachi Express scheduled to be arrived Karachi at 12:00 A.M. on Friday but the train reached at 2:00 A.M. with one box missing out of the ten.

According to sources, 16 Police officers and a SBP official were deputed on the security of prize bonds.

The high profile officials of SBP remained aware about the incident even after several hours passed of the tragedy, sources informed.

According to latest information, the bank has canceled the numbers prize bond, got stolen during transportation.

Furthermore, the Karachi Police Chief has constituted a three-member team to conduct the investigation.
